An AX.25 packet radio chat protocol with support for digital signatures and binary compression. Like IRC over radio waves 📡. Chattervox implements a minimal packet radio protocol on top of AX.25 that can be used with a terminal node controller (TNC) like Direwolf to transmit and receive digitally signed messages using audio frequency shift keying modulation (AFSK). In the United States, it's illegal to broadcast encrypted messages on amateur radio frequencies. Chattervox respects this law, while using elliptic curve cryptography and digital signatures to protect against message spoofing.

hfterm - linux ham radio soundcard digimode program, can monitor and transmit PACTOR I (unique !), also AMTOR, GTOR, RTTY. Based on hfkernel by Tom Sailer, with graphic interface (gtk+), spectrum display, logbook, textmacros, English and German help.

It allows you to predict the position of any satellite in real time or in the past or future. It uses advanced SGP4/SDP4 algorithms developed by NASA/NORAD to propagate the satellite orbits.
SaVi - satellite constellation visualization. Simulate Iridium, Globalstar, O3b, Sirius Radio, GPS, Galileo and other systems, modify them, or design your own. Uses Tcl/Tk and Unix libraries; 3D viewing option requires Geomview running on X Window.
